Ventilation
Many homeowners overlook the soffit and fascia replacement near me and soffit and guttering replacement near me, yet these essential components are essential to keeping your home well-ventilated. They guard the feet of roof rafters and prevent the accumulation of water in the attic or soffit which can cause wood rot, mold, and mildew. They also serve as a barrier against insects, birds and other vermin that might try to nest inside your attic or roof.
The soffit is fixed to the fascia's bottom board and can be constructed from a variety of materials, including vinyl, aluminum, cement or Fascias & soffits wood. It is usually vented so that air can be able to flow into the attic. This can reduce energy consumption, and can also help prevent moisture from building up on the roof.
Wood soffits, although popular due to their natural look they are also susceptible to mold and mildew issues. To keep their appearance, they also require staining or painted frequently. Aluminum, on the other hand is light and doesn't require painting. It is also resistant to insects, and fungus. This makes it a great choice for homeowners looking for a durable, attractive fascia or soffit board.
Vinyl is also a popular choice for soffit and fascia boards. It is available in a variety of colors and looks similar to wood or metal. It is easy to install and requires less work than aluminum or wood. It comes in wood grain and smooth finishes, and is available in pre-formed panels that you can easily blend it into your home's exterior style.
Homeowners should check their fascia and soffit to make sure they are in good shape. They should be looking for mildew and mold, and other indications of moisture. They should also look for bee, hornet and wasp nests, removing them before they become a problem. The homeowner should then take steps to prevent water from entering their home by cleaning soffit, fascia and gutters with bleach and water solutions. To prolong the life of soffit and fascia, homeowners should also keep leaves and branches away from them.

It's vital to check your soffits and fascias, as well as your roofline for signs of damage. Cracking and rotting are common indications that your soffit or fascia might require repair or replacement and can be costly if left untreated. Wear and tear visible can also be a sign of a pest infestation. This is a serious problem that should be addressed right away.
Regularly cleaning your fascia and soffit is an effective way to maintain their appearance and to prevent moisture penetration. You can use a garden hose and soft brush or spray using a low-pressure cleaner. However, you should always avoid vigorous rubbing or cleaning with a high-pressure washer, which could damage the material.
